The Procedure: What to Expect

Vaginal tightening surgery typically involves the removal of excess vaginal tissue and the tightening of the surrounding muscles. The procedure can be done through various techniques, including traditional surgery or laser treatments. Traditional methods often require an incision, while laser techniques are less invasive and utilize focused light energy to promote tissue contraction.

The procedure is usually performed under anesthesia, and recovery time varies depending on the approach taken. For those undergoing traditional surgery, a few days to weeks of recovery may be necessary, with a longer period for full healing. In contrast, those opting for laser treatments may experience less downtime and can resume daily activities sooner.

Recovery and Aftercare:

Following vaginal tightening surgery, it is essential to follow proper aftercare instructions to ensure optimal healing. While the recovery process varies for each individual, there are common guidelines to consider. Most patients are advised to avoid sexual activity for a few weeks to allow the area to heal. It is also important to follow instructions regarding physical activities, as heavy lifting or strenuous exercises can delay healing.

Patients may experience some discomfort, swelling, or bruising in the initial days after the procedure. These symptoms typically subside with time, and over-the-counter pain relievers can help manage any mild discomfort. It is crucial to attend follow-up appointments to monitor healing and address any concerns that arise during recovery.

Potential Risks and Complications:

Like any surgical procedure, vaginal tightening surgery carries some risks. While rare, complications can include infection, bleeding, scarring, or dissatisfaction with the final results. It is vital to choose a qualified healthcare provider to minimize these risks and ensure a safe outcome. Patients should be aware of the possibility of temporary or permanent changes in sensation, as the procedure can affect nerve function in the vaginal area.

Before undergoing surgery, it is important to discuss any concerns or potential complications with a healthcare provider. They can provide a clear understanding of the risks and help set realistic expectations for the results. Proper preoperative assessments and clear communication are essential for a successful surgery and recovery.

Long-Term Results and Maintenance:

Vaginal tightening surgery typically offers long-lasting results, but it is important to maintain a healthy lifestyle to preserve the benefits. Engaging in pelvic floor exercises, such as Kegels, can help strengthen the muscles and maintain tone over time. Additionally, maintaining a healthy weight, avoiding excessive strain during physical activities, and practicing good pelvic health habits can contribute to the longevity of the results.

While vaginal rejuvenation can restore tightness and function, it is important to remember that the body continues to age. As such, some individuals may experience a gradual loss of muscle tone over the years. Regular check-ups and consistent self-care practices can help sustain the improvements achieved through the procedure.
